From The Editor’s Desk: To Grow a More Diverse Startup Ecosystem, Start At The Seed Stage
Crunchbase’s first Diversity Spotlight Report underscores the extent to which minority entrepreneurs are largely shut out from participating in the wealth generated by the tech industry. So far in 2020, Black and Latino founders have raised just 2.6 percent of the total VC funding for US , despite the two demographic groups combining to make up 32 percent of the US population. Although this article notes that there are no quick fixes for systemic inequality, it highlights one area in the report that the venture industry can improve upon more immediately: seed-state funding.

Female Founders Alliance report measures impact of pandemic on women and entrepreneurship
Seattle-based Female Founders Alliance recently released a new report that measures the effect of the pandemic on women and non-binary individuals, and how the health and economic crisis has affected their entrepreneurial goals. This GeekWire article highlights the ways in which the pandemic has exacerbated existing structural problems faced by female entrepreneurs. It also summarizes the report and analyzes its findings.

The September 2020 US Venture Capital Funding Report
This article reviews the state of venture capital and seed funding during the month of September nationally, during which over $9.5 billion was invested into US . The article breaks down the aggregate statistics for all funding deals by stage of funding, including Early Stage, Series A, Series B and Late Stage
